WebJan 14, 2024 · Skin issues and allergies are common in dogs with shorter coats like the Boxer. This breed specifically deals with skin issues like: Canine Acne. Endocrine Diseases. Itchiness – caused by food/environmental allergies. Alopecia. Hypothyroidism. Boxer skin issues can be linked back to their short coats and allergies. WebBoxers frequently suffer from hypothyroidism, or low levels of thyroid hormone. Clinical signs of the condition often manifest as skin ailments.
